#e7da77 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e7da77 is composed of 90.6% red, 85.5% green and 46.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 5.6% magenta, 48.5%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 53 degrees, a saturation of 70% and a lightness of 68.6%. #e7da77 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ffee with #cfb500.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c66.

Shades and Tints of #e7da77
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0d02 is the darkest color, while #fffef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#e7da77
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b0afae is the less saturated color, while #f9e865 is the most saturated one.
